What you will do:



  • Adjust and operate sheet metal stackers, electrostatic waxer, waxing machine, bundle turners, and related equipment.

  • Remove stacked metal from stacking equipment.

  • Clean machines and equipment using belts, wire, and guides.

  • Visually inspect coated and sheet metal and remove defective sheets such as missing coating or litho, off-color, drip marks, bends, scratches, dirt, and damaged. Record defects.

  • Assist Operator in setting up coating machine and changing coating rolls.

  • Record process and production data, monitor process control charts, and take corrective action.

  • Use digital thickness gauge to measure coated sheet.

  • Match coating colors to required standards.

  • Record and process production data for use in SPC process, using SPC tools and other techniques

  • Follow all Plant food safety procedures
